Settling the Estate of my late Father and up for auction is his numbers matching 1969 Jaguar XKE 2+2 coupe Series 2 LHD 4.2 litre, dohc, dual stromberg, 4-speed manual, w/Air conditioning. It is with a very heavy heart that we have to list this car for sale however, other financial obligations are taking precedence at this time. This car was last on the road in 2002 and has been in storage ever since. The car has been owned by our family for the past 30+ years I believe my father was the second owner. We have a current transferable registration and will write a bill of sale at the time the vehicle sells. NYS does not have titles for vehicles this old they have transferable registrations. The pictures are recent as we just pulled it out of storage this week.We are not going to wash it for all you barn find fanatics out there. As stated we pulled the car out of storage last week, took it to our shop which was owned by my father, now my brother and proceeded to get it running. It didn"t take much, we started with draining the fuel tank, cleaned the spark plugs out, topped off all the fluids, checked the oil and installed a new battery. Turn the key and bam it started right up and I was instantly reminded of riding in the passenger seat with my dad as a kid and that sound I would never forget. Car is very solid but will need a complete restoration and is sold as is. The only soft spots I could find are in the front corner of the lower rockers under the car. I assume common for these cars. The engine, transmission and clutch all perform like they should and with little work (brakes etc) it could be a weekend driver. The air cleaner is included it just didn't make it into the pictures. My father drove this car up until 2002 when we then stored it. Car is equipped with factory air conditioning and steel wheels. The original color was light blue and all the door jams engine bay reflect that. Interior is dark blue, we have some new interior parts not installed,another arm rest, we also have some extra door glass, doors, wheel caps and some other misc parts. Evo pits Jaguar XKR-S vs. Mercedes SL63 AMG in heavyweight droptop fight

Wed, 12 Mar 2014

We recently received the sad news that the Jaguar XK is ceasing production by the end of the year, but what better way to bid it farewell than with some big, smoky powerslides? The retirement of the sporty GT isn't actually the topic of the latest video from Evo - it's on hand to compete against the Mercedes-Benz SL63 AMG to see which is faster around a track. Still, we can think of it as a wonderful sendoff for the Jag.
Both convertible grand tourers get their laps around the course, and they couldn't be more different. Driver Jethro Bovingdon gets some grins out of them both, but absolutely giggles while behind the wheel of the XKR-S convertible. The SL63 AMG is the more powerful of the two, but as we know, that doesn't always matter at a racetrack. Land Rover could build a baby Defender on a platform sourced from BMW

Mon, Aug 12 2019

The collaboration between BMW and Jaguar-Land Rover started out small, it was originally limited to motors for electric cars, but it might not stay that way for long. The Tata-owned British sister companies will allegedly rummage through Munich's sizable parts bin to build nearly half a dozen cars scheduled to come out during the 2020s. According to a report by British magazine Autocar, Jaguar has started designing two small cars that will join its growing family of Pace-badged soft-roaders. They'll be new additions to the firm's portfolio, not replacements for existing cars. One will be a regular crossover, while the other will be a swoopier, form-over-function four-door model ostensibly marketed as a coupe. Both will slot at the very bottom of the Jaguar portfolio, below the already pretty small E-Pace, in a growing market segment where the competition is fierce, and profit margins are thinner than an i3's tires. Here's where BMW apparently comes in. Instead of developing a platform from scratch, the two crossovers could ride on the hybrid-ready, front-wheel drive FAAR architecture found under the third-generation 1 Series hatchback and the upcoming 2 Series Gran Coupe. If we believe an earlier report claiming Jaguar and BMW will also share engines, most of the hardware found under the sheet metal will have German genes. All-wheel drive will certainly be available, and it could also come from BMW. The same platform -- and, presumably, the same engines -- would provide the basis for a Land Rover-badged model positioned in the same segment. Autocar learned it will be to the next-generation Defender (pictured) what the Mercedes-Benz GLB is to the G-Class. Some key design cues will carry over, but the two models will share absolutely nothing under the sheet metal. The soft-roader could resurrect the Freelander nameplate when it goes on sale during the 2020s. Looking even further ahead, the front-wheel-drive platform the next Mini Countryman and X1 will utilize could find its way under the replacements for the next Range Rover Evoque and Discovery Sport. These plans could very well change; the Evoque and the Disco Sport barely entered their second generation, so they're not due for a replacement until the second half of the coming decade. While neither company has confirmed or denied the report, the partnership makes sense from a business standpoint.
